Chief John Ross Scholarship Honors Legacy of Mary Golda Ross and Invests in Native STEM Students
The Chief John Ross Scholarship continues a legacy of Cherokee leadership, education, and scientific achievement rooted in the life and work of Mary Golda Ross, the great-great-granddaughter of Chief John Ross.

Award-Winning Cherokee Artists to Headline RCCA February Meeting in Claremore
Artist Greg Stice, founder of Cherokee Copper, creates modern Native American jewelry inspired by Cherokee history and symbolism. Working alongside him are his children, Moriah and Joshua, both award-winning Cherokee artists. Together, the family continues a legacy of craftsmanship and cultural pride.

Native-Owned Gen II Fire Protection Named Top 10 Provider, Serves as Preferred Vendor for Six Oklahoma Tribes
By Cara Cowan Watts, Cherokee 411 OKLAHOMA. Gen II Fire Protection, a Native-owned fire protection services company based in Oklahoma, continues to expand its regional footprint while earning national recognition for its comprehensive, client-focused approach to fire safety. Owned by Muscogee Creek Nation citizen Bryan Drinnon II, Gen II Fire Protection was founded in 2018 and provides full-service commercial and industrial fire protection across Oklahoma, Kansas, Arkansas, and Missouri.
